> Why on earth can't Apache link to LGPL libraries? What's with you guys?
> Have you heard about something called "the open source community"? It's
> about reusing code n'allthat...

have you never heard of 'viral licensing'?  the reason is, quite
simply, that linking to lgpl stuff will cause our stuff to be
licensed under lgpl instead of staying licensed under the apache
licence.  and that's something from which we have decided to
protect our users.  if *they* want to modify the code to do
this stuff, fine -- but not our original sources for the above reason.
we're not going to force the 3p commercial vendors who base
their products on our code into any form of [l]gpl compliance.
that's something they need to do themselves, with their eyes open.
